Output 77050250487fce5338b4a5a5c5245195203b68c8662c8eae3e57db818f8ecd7d:0

value
3574634
script pubkey
OP_0 OP_PUSHBYTES_20 dc3eeb106374a1847eb21dc992590d2cf898bfc6
address
bc1qmslwkyrrwjscgl4jrhyeykgd9nuf307xmw385u
transaction
77050250487fce5338b4a5a5c5245195203b68c8662c8eae3e57db818f8ecd7d
spent
true